Important Points

FOOD WASTE, PLASTIC PACKAGING, STRAPPING etc
MUST NOT BE PLACED IN THE BIN WITH YOUR CARD.

Can I mix garden waste and cardboard? 
Yes! at the composting plant, they are shredded and mixed together, and card aids the composting process.

If I haven't got a green garden wheelie bin?
Most properties have been issued with garden bins, but if you declined a garden bin originally, contact us to order one.  
Only town and village centre properties have bag recycling, and red bags are not available for other areas.

Very small amounts of card - flat and no larger than A4 (magazine) size, can be placed with your plastic bottle and cans recycling, but most card and large card must be in the garden wheelie bin.
